What Went Down in the Nintendo Direct
Metroid Prime 4: Beyond, developed by Retro Studios, puts you back in Samus Aran’s power suit for a first-person adventure on the alien planet Viewros. The trailer, covered by IGN, introduced new psychic abilities for Samus, letting her tackle enemies and puzzles in fresh ways. The Switch 2 version is set to shine with 4K resolution at 60 FPS when docked and 1080p at 120 FPS handheld, thanks to the console’s beefy NVIDIA Tegra X2 chip and 16GB of RAM. GameSpot has all the juicy tech details if you want to geek out on the specs.
There’s also a new mouse-mode feature for the Joy-Con, making aiming smoother than ever—perfect for a Metroid Prime game. Nintendo didn’t pin down an exact date but teased a 2025 release, likely tied to the Switch 2’s Q4 launch, as confirmed on Nintendo’s official site.
